CEPHALOBIDAE


Meaning of CEPHALOBIDAE in English

ˌsefəˈlōbəˌdē noun plural

Usage: capitalized

Etymology: New Latin, from Cephalobus, type genus (probably irregular from cephal- + -lobus ) + -idae

: a family of rhabditoid nematode worms that are saprophagous or associated with the roots of plants — compare vinegar eel
